Hazard Identification and Risk Assessment for Non-Specialists
2 days|Delivered on request
Hazard Identification and Risk Assessment for Non-Specialists is built for delegates who need to be useful in this area quickly. It starts at first principles and works through contractor safety management and environmental impact assessment without assuming prior specialist training. The programme exists because safety systems are often documented to a standard that daily practice does not match, and because capability in this area is usually built on the job with no structure behind it. Delegates leave able to work confidently with occupational hygiene, working at height and waste management in their own organisation.
